| Diagnosis |
This species is distinguished by the following characters: D 16-17, of moderate height, no rays filamentous in either sex, the third and fourth rays are the longest, only slightly longer than shortest rays at middle of fin, 16.9-23.1% SL in males and females, distal margin nearly straight in both sexes, only slightly concave; caudal peduncle length 13.4-18.7% SL; distance from anus to anal fin origin 1.5-2.2 in distance from pelvic fin origin to anus; head length 30.1-33.3% SL; orbital diameter 10.1-11.8% SL; interorbital width 4.0-5.5% SL; snout length 7.6-9.0% SL; upper jaw length 14.5-16.2% SL; pectoral fin length 19.1-22.1% SL; pelvic fin length 23.7-29.5% SL; 9-11 scales between anus and anal fin origin; reddish overall with deep red saddles (Ref. 105374). |
